Skipping a single practice day can wipe out two to three days’ worth of motor skill progress. The loss remains invisible at first because the immediate sensation is only a small drop in fluency, but muscle memory consolidation operates on a tight schedule. A gap of 24 hours interferes with the neural reinforcement that solidifies the movement pattern after a session. Those isolated missed days quietly accumulate, eventually locking the learner into a plateau that more practice alone will not break.
When One Gap Derails Progress for Weeks
The problem hits hardest for anyone building physical precision – a student shaping bowing accuracy on a violin, a tennis player grooving a serve, or a speaker retraining a foreign sound. In a typical sequence, a practitioner skips Tuesday without noticing any deficit on Thursday, so the trade-off seems harmless. By Friday, however, the neural firing pattern that was flagged for strengthening on Monday night has already degraded. Two weeks later, the same passage feels as clumsy as it did earlier, and the learner attributes the stall to lack of aptitude instead of a chain of seemingly trivial daily gaps.
How a Single Missed Session Triggers a Cascade
The 24-Hour Consolidation Window That Needs Follow-Through
Motor memory does not harden at the moment of practice. The brain tags the movement as significant, then transfers and stabilizes it during sleep in a process called consolidation. The catch is that this stabilization depends on a reactivation within roughly the next day or two. Without it, the fragile memory trace competes with other inputs and is pruned. A skipped day means the consolidation started after Monday’s practice never gets the Tuesday reinforcement, so Wednesday arrives with a partially lost gain. One gap inside this critical window cancels the brain’s overnight sorting work.
The Steep First-Day Decay for Complex Movement
Physical skills obey a forgetting curve, but for intricate motor sequences the earliest drop is disproportionately sharp. Within 24 hours of no practice, fine coordination blurs. A pianist who misses a day after drilling a difficult four-bar phrase will often misfinger the transitions that felt automatic the session before. The decay is non-linear – the first gap causes the steepest decline because the movement representation is still diffuse. Push the gap to two days and performance accuracy can fall back to where it stood two or three sessions earlier, erasing the investment of time.
Why a Broken Streak Multiplies the Damage
A practice streak acts as a behavioral anchor. Habit research demonstrates that skipping a planned session disrupts the cue-routine-reward loop that makes practice automatic. Once the chain snaps, the brain demotes the priority of the activity, and restarting becomes harder. A single gap is often followed by a second, then a third – not from laziness, but because the internal signal “this is what we do now” has been silenced. The original missed day’s cost then multiplies as the habit erodes.
Sharp Corrections to Common Thinking on Rest and Muscle Memory
A Rest Day Is Not the Same as a Zero-Contact Day
Recovery is critical for muscles, but a day of total disengagement from a skill under early consolidation sacrifices gains that a five-minute refresher would have preserved. The neural pathway requires a small maintenance input even on low-intensity days. Recovery for the physical system and a minimal motor signal can coexist; they are separate resources.
Doubling Tomorrow’s Practice Cannot Reopen the Window
Cramming after a gap does not restore the missed consolidation step. Motor learning operates best through short, spaced exposures, not marathon blocks. An extra hour risks fatigue, embeds sloppy technique, and delivers diminishing returns. The closed consolidation window cannot be reopened by effort; it demands consistency, not compensation.
Muscle Memory Is Not Permanent During the Fragile Phase
Overlearned skills can survive long layoffs, but the initial weeks of training are delicate. Neural representations are still being pruned and organized. A missed day during this window disrupts that process, causing faster forgetting than a missed day would after the skill is automated. Even then, precision and timing decay sooner than gross movement, so a single gap can regress a polished skill back to a rougher version.
Direct Answers to the Questions People Search
How much progress is lost from skipping one practice day?
For a skill in early acquisition, one missed day can set performance back one to three prior sessions, depending on complexity. The neural trace decays fastest without reactivation. The setback is rarely obvious that same week; it surfaces in stalled month-over-month improvement.
Does the skill type change the cost of skipping a day?
Yes. Fine motor skills demanding precise timing and coordination – instrumental practice, a golf swing change – degrade faster than gross motor patterns. Skills still undergoing error-based adjustment are far more vulnerable to a single-day gap than fully consolidated routines.
Can you make up for a missed day by practicing twice as long?
Not in a way that offsets the loss. Motor learning relies on sleep-dependent consolidation and repeated brief exposures. Doubling the next session invites mental and physical fatigue, degrading training quality. The soundest strategy is to resume the normal schedule and, if possible, add one short, focused refresher – but never replace consistency with volume.
What is the most reliable way to keep a practice streak alive?
Anchor the habit to an existing daily trigger and define a minimum viable practice – something so small it feels trivial, like a single scale or five free throws. On low-energy days, that minimum keeps the neural circuit active and the streak psychology intact. Tracking the streak visually, such as marking a wall calendar, leverages the brain’s aversion to breaking a chain.
Is it ever wise to skip a day deliberately?
Planned breaks can prevent burnout when they are part of a deliberate schedule rather than impulsive omissions. The effective version is to designate the day a “maintenance day” that still includes two minutes of contact with the skill – a single repetition or a mental walkthrough – to close the consolidation gap and preserve the habit cue. The danger lies in the unplanned, casual skip that ignores the hidden compound cost.
